설명
Film noir captivates audiences with its distinctive visual style and complex narratives, often exploring themes of moral ambiguity and existential despair. James Naremore delves into the evolution of this genre, tracing its roots from the shadows of classic Hollywood to its modern interpretations.
Through insightful analysis, Naremore addresses the challenges of defining film noir while highlighting its cultural significance. With sharp observations on key films and figures, he illuminates how this genre continues to influence filmmakers and resonate with viewers, inviting them to reconsider the darker aspects of the human experience.
